Thursday TV Show Ratings: Glee, Scandal, Person of Interest, Hannibal, The Office

April 25 ratingsThursday, April 25, 2013 ratingsNew Episodes: The Big Bang Theory, Two and a Half Men, Person of Interest, Elementary, Community, Parks and Recreation, The Office, Hannibal, American Idol, Glee, Wife Swap, Grey’s Anatomy, Scandal, The Vampire Diaries, and Beauty And The Beast. Episode Reruns: The Office.

ABC
8pmWife Swap: 1.1 in the demo (-27% change) with 3.57 million.
9pmGrey’s Anatomy: 2.7 in the demo (-4% change) with 8.12 million.
10pmScandal: 2.8 in the demo (+8% change) with 7.76 million.

CBS
8pmThe Big Bang Theory: 4.2 in the demo (-19% change) with 14.38 million.
8:30pmTwo and a Half Men: 2.8 in the demo (-28% change) with 11.03 million.
9pmPerson of Interest: 2.4 in the demo (-11% change) with 12.99 million.
10pmElementary: 2.0 in the demo (-5% change) with 9.94 million.

The CW:
8pmThe Vampire Diaries: 0.9 in the demo (-10% change) with 2.15 million.
9pmBeauty and the Beast: 0.5 in the demo (-17% change) with 1.29 million.

FOX
8pmAmerican Idol: 2.7 in the demo (-10% change) with 11.11 million.
9pmGlee: 1.8 in the demo (-14% change) with 5.24 million.

NBC
8pmCommunity: 1.0 in the demo (-23% change) with 2.40 million.
8:30pmThe Office: (rerun) 0.9 in the demo with 1.84 million.
9pmThe Office: 1.7 in the demo (-11% change) with 3.13 million.
9:30pmParks and Recreation: 1.3 in the demo (-24% change) with 2.54 million.
10pmHannibal: 1.0 in the demo (-29% change) with 2.40 million.

These are the fast affiliate ratings. The “demo” refers to the viewers in the 18-49 demographic. The percentages represent the change since the previous original episode. (Percentages aren’t given for reruns or specials.) “Million” refers to the total number of viewers.
